About The Position

The AI Enablement Lead serves as M Financial's primary catalyst for practical AI adoption. This role identifies high-friction workflows, redesigns them with AI capabilities, and drives measurable improvements in productivity and experience for employees and Member Firms. Acting as the organization's central point of contact for AI implementation and enablement, the AI Enablement Lead partners with business stakeholders, technology teams, and leadership to build confidence, demonstrate impact, and embed AI into how work gets done, not just how tasks are completed. AI adoption doesn't happen through access alone. This role closes the gap between AI availability and AI impact by redesigning workflows, building organizational confidence, and delivering measurable productivity gains across M Financial and its Member Firms.

Requirements

  • 3-6 years of experience in operations, technology, consulting, or business analysis
  • Demonstrated ability to improve processes, workflows, or user experience leveraging AI
  • Familiarity with AI solution categories beyond conversational AI, including agentic workflows, intelligent automation, and document intelligence
  • Strong problem-solving skills with a bias toward action and execution
  • Ability to translate business needs into clear, practical solutions
  • Experience using modern AI tools (e.g., Microsoft Copilot, Claude, ChatGPT, or similar platforms)
  • Experience turning complex, repeatable business tasks into AI-supported workflows that can plan the work, complete steps, check results, and improve over time.
  • Experience building or contributing to business cases for technology investments
  • Experience with change management methodologies or organizational adoption programs
  • Experience designing or delivering training, workshops, or enablement content for varied audiences
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ills; ability to influence across functions
  • High level of curiosity, ownership, and accountability

Responsibilities

  • Identify high-friction workflows and lead the redesign of those processes to embed AI where it creates the most value
  • Design, test, and deploy AI-enabled solutions that improve speed, accuracy, and user experience
  • Partner with business teams to understand needs and align solutions to measurable outcomes
  • Act as a bridge between business stakeholders and AI/technology capabilities
  • Manage and report on the AI use case portfolio, including business case development, prioritization frameworks, and executive-level impact reporting
  • Develop repeatable playbooks for common use cases (e.g., summarization, drafting, analysis, workflow support)
  • Build and sustain an internal network of AI champions across business units and Member Firms to scale adoption beyond direct engagement
  • Lead change management efforts that address adoption barriers, build user confidence, and reinforce new ways of working
  • Serve as the organization's AI evangelist, making AI approachable and visible through regular communication, demos, and success stories
  • Drive adoption by making AI practical and embedded into daily workflows
  • Track and report on impact including time savings, productivity improvements, and quality gains
  • Design and deliver role-based enablement programs, including workshops, playbooks, and self-service resources tailored to different levels of AI fluency
  • Partner with legal, risk, compliance, HR, and security teams to address adoption barriers and ensure AI initiatives meet regulatory and workforce requirements
  • Stay current on emerging AI capabilities, including agentic AI, workflow automation, and intelligent document processing, and evaluate their applicability to M Financial's operations and Member Firm need
